- Abstract
- "The etiology of ischemic stroke remains undetermined in nearly 40% of patients despite extensive evaluations.
Coagulopathies associated with cerebrovascular ischemia may be familial or acquired and account for 4% of all strokes.
The four important naturally occurring circulation proteins that inhibit coagulation are protein C, protein S, antithrombin
III, and heparin cofactor II. A carefully balanced interaction between these proteins and normal vascular endothelial
cells comprise a major barrier inhibiting thrombosis. The true deficiencies of these proteins are usually inherited
although many conditions such as DIC, malignancy, malnutrition, infection, and neutropenia can be associated with
acquired deficiencies. Although some data suggest an association between arterial strokes and the deficiency of these
proteins in young adults, cerebral venous thrombosis and venous infarcts gave been reported far more commonly with
deficiencies of any of these proteins. The understanding of the molecular events underlying coagulation has improved in
recent years. This has led to development of specific assays that can identify genetic abnormalities which can cause
coagulopathies. Although the technology has improved the fundamental approach to the patient has not changed. A primary
care physician requires a basic knowledge of the principles of blood coagulation so as to treat patients with simple
problems and refer patients with more unusual or complex disorders on to the specialist. The recognition that hypercoagulable
states are sometimes found in ischemic stroke patients has led to testing for these rare conditions.
Coagulopathies related to protein C, protein S, or antithrombin III deficiencies, activated protein C resistance, prothrombin
gene mutation, anticardiolipin antibodies, or lupus anticoagulant can be evaluated with various coagulation
testing strategies."
